A Forebitter reunion

I always thought of Mystic's Forebitter as the Crosby, Still, Nash & Young of sea chanty and maritime music.

Indeed, Forebitter - Rick Spencer, Craig Edwards, Geoff Kaufman and David Littlefield - achieved supergroup-style success for their international festival appearances and over the course of four amazing and wide-reaching albums.

The group, which stayed together almost two decades before amiably splitting up a few years back, reunites for a performance Saturday in Branford's First Congregational Church. It marks the season finale of the Branford Folk Music Society - and the briny material and exuberant harmonies provide a fine way to usher in the water-happy summer season.
